Marriage: Marriage solemnised in the Church in the parish of St James the Great in the county of Middlesex, according to the rights and ceremonies of the Established Church, by banns. John Charles LLOYD, of full age, bachelor, copper smith, of Bethnal Green (father: John LLOYD, timekeeper) and Emma FRANKLIN, aged 18, spinster, of 7 William St (father: John FRANKLIN, carman). Emma signed with her mark. Witnesses were Benjamin FRANKLIN and Annie LLOYD. |
